Malatleng currently has an office in Witbank and offers the following services:

Site supervision. Ron Saunders our newest member liaises with farmers, land occupiers and lays out all the boreholes with our GPS. He is on site during the week and liaises daily with the drillers, geologists, wire line loggers and clients. Ron ensures that the drillers sites are clean and that they adhere to the Health & Safety requirements. He also ensures that all the logistics associated with placing boreholes, communicating with our core loggers, surveyors, farmers and drillers runs smoothly and efficiently on each site. Ron checks and photographs the site rehabilitation on completion of each borehole.

Core logging. Our loggers log core in the field according to the clients’ specifications. Samples are taken according to client standards and delivered to the laboratories. Malatleng currently offers coal logging but can call on various subcontractors for other commodities. A thorough check is kept on sample names, depths and masses as well as core recoveries and the general drilling standards.

Data capture. All bore hole data is captured electronically and processed according to client specifications. Examples of Malatleng’s coal logging out-put in PDF or jpeg. format is shown below. All raw data, analytical data and processed data can either be placed on a web folder with a secure password fore the client’s easy access or burnt on to a DVD and delivered.

Geophysical Logging. We can contract in geophysical logging using Anko Geophysics or Geoline. We are currently investigating the purchase of our own geophysical logging equipment.

Geotechnical logging. Malatleng has an arrangement with a private consultat Gerald Letlatsa who has a number of years of geotechnical logging experience.
